Dachi Gubadze

Chief Operating Officer at Stack Browser

Dachi Gubadze's email address, phone number and social links are

Others working in Stack Browser

David Gavasheli

Co-Founder

Email
View
Phone
View

Dachi Gubadze's current Workspace

Company Name

Stack Browser

Revenue

$1 - 10M

Industry

Software & Internet

Head Count

25 - 100

Location

United States

People similar to Dachi Gubadze

Dachi Gubadze

Chief Operational Officer at Stack

Email
View
Phone
View

Ad Hoeks

Chief Operating Officer at Brain research center

Email
View
Phone
View

Knaar Visser

Chief Operating Officer at Media Buying Systems

Email
View
Phone
View

Charles Dekker

Chief Operating Officer at Asset People

Email
View
Phone
View

Joren Olthoff

Chief Operating Officer at XRBASE

Email
View
Phone
View

Mark Faber

Chief Operating Officer at Faber Flags

Email
View
Phone
View

Frequently Asked Questions

Browse Our Directories
People Search